#!/usr/bin/python
from telethon import TelegramClient
from telegram import Update # * upm package(python-telegram-bot)
from telegram.ext import Updater, CommandHandler, MessageHandler, Filters, CallbackContext #upm package(python-telegram-bot)
import os
import lib_v2_globals as g
import lib_v2_ohlc as o
import psutil
import time, datetime
import subprocess
from subprocess import Popen
g.issue = o.get_issue()
lary = [
["h", "help_command", "Help"],
["start", "help_command", "Help"],
["#", "------------", "------"],
["dbs", "dbstat_command", "DB status"],
["rdb", "restart_db_command", "Restart DB"],
["bs", "botstat_command", "Bot status"],
["sus", "suspend_command", "Suspend bot"],
["res", "resume_command", "Resume bot"],
["sbot", "stopbot_command", "Stop bot"],
["rbot", "restartbot_command", "(re)start bot"],
["rlis", "restart_lis_command", "Restart listener"],
["klis", "kill_lis_command", "Kill listener"],
["#", "------------", "------"],
["df", "df_command", "'df -h'"],
["tail", "tail_command", "Tail nohup"],
["tl", "tail_listener_command","Tail listener.log"],
["#", "------------", "------"],
["btb", "bt_bal_command", "BT Bal"],
["bsa", "bt_sallall_command", "BT sell all BTC"],
["#", "------------", "------"],
["vvp", "b_plotvolprice_command", "Plot vol/price"],
["vdp", "b_plotdepth_command", "Plot depth"],
["vp", "b_plotprofit_command", "Plot profit"],
["#", "------------", "------"],
["x", "x_command", "test args"],
]
def loqreq(msg):
with open("logs/listener.log", 'a+') as file:
file.write(f"[{get_timestamp()}] {msg}\n")
def get_timestamp():
tt = datetime.datetime.fromtimestamp(time.time())
ts = tt.strftime("%b %d %Y %H:%M:%S")
return f"{ts}"
def getsecs():
tt = datetime.datetime.fromtimestamp(time.time())
secs = int(tt.strftime("%S"))
return 60-secs
def touch(fn):
with open(fn, 'w') as file:
file.write("")
def checkIfProcessRunning(processName):
for proc in psutil.process_iter():
try:
for i in proc.cmdline():
if i.find(processName) != -1:
return i
except (psutil.NoSuchProcess, psutil.AccessDenied, psutil.ZombieProcess):
pass
return False
def killProcessRunning(processName):
for proc in psutil.process_iter():
try:
for i in proc.cmdline():
if i.find(processName) != -1:
proc.kill()
return f"{proc.pid} killed"
except (psutil.NoSuchProcess, psutil.AccessDenied, psutil.ZombieProcess):
pass
return False
def statProcess(processName):
for proc in psutil.process_iter():
try:
for i in proc.cmdline():
if i.find(processName) != -1:
id = proc.pid
nm = proc.name()
ir = proc.is_running()
return f"{id}: {nm} up:{ir}"
except (psutil.NoSuchProcess, psutil.AccessDenied, psutil.ZombieProcess):
pass
return False
def suspendProcess(processName):
for proc in psutil.process_iter():
try:
for i in proc.cmdline():
if i.find(processName) != -1:
proc.suspend()
nm = proc.name()
return f"SUSPENDED: {nm}"
except (psutil.NoSuchProcess, psutil.AccessDenied, psutil.ZombieProcess):
pass
return False
def resumeProcess(processName):
for proc in psutil.process_iter():
try:
for i in proc.cmdline():
if i.find(processName) != -1:
proc.resume()
nm = proc.name()
return f"RESUMED: {nm}"
except (psutil.NoSuchProcess, psutil.AccessDenied, psutil.ZombieProcess):
pass
return False
g.keys = o.get_secret()
api_id = g.keys['telegram']['api_id']
api_hash = g.keys['telegram']['api_hash']
session_location = g.keys['telegram']['session_location']
#* for LOCAL
sessionfile = f"{session_location}/v2bot_cmd.session"
token = g.keys['telegram']['v2bot_cmd_token']
if g.issue == "REMOTE":
sessionfile = f"{session_location}/v2bot_remote_cmd.session"
token = g.keys['telegram']['v2bot_remote_cmd_token']
print(f"loading: {sessionfile}")
client = TelegramClient(sessionfile, api_id, api_hash)
# client.send_message(5081499662, f'listeningv...')
def help_command(update: Update, context: CallbackContext) -> None:
htext = ""
for i in range(len(lary)):
if lary[i][0] != "#":
htext += f"/{lary[i][0]} {lary[i][2]}\n"
else:
htext += "\n"
update.message.reply_text(htext)
def bt_bal_command(update: Update, context: CallbackContext) -> None:
command = "./b_balances.py > /tmp/_b_bal"
os.system(command)
with open('/tmp/_b_bal', 'r') as file: htext = file.read()
update.message.reply_text(htext)
def bt_sallall_command(update: Update, context: CallbackContext) -> None:
command = "./b_sellallbtc.py > /tmp/_b_sellall"
os.system(command)
with open('/tmp/_b_sellall', 'r') as file: htext = file.read()
update.message.reply_text(htext)
def b_plotvolprice_command(update: Update, context: CallbackContext) -> None:
command = "./b_plot_volprice.py > /dev/null 2>&1"
os.system(command)
update.message.reply_document(document=open("images/plot_volprice.png",'rb'))
os.remove("images/plot_volprice.png")
def b_plotdepth_command(update: Update, context: CallbackContext) -> None:
command = "./b_plot_depth.py > /dev/null 2>&1"
os.system(command)
update.message.reply_document(document=open("images/plot_depth.png",'rb'))
os.remove("images/plot_depth.png")
def b_plotprofit_command(update: Update, context: CallbackContext) -> None:
command = "./j_plot_profit.py > /dev/null 2>&1"
os.system(command)
update.message.reply_document(document=open("images/plot_profit.png",'rb'))
os.remove("images/plot_profit.png")
def dbstat_command(update: Update, context: CallbackContext) -> None:
if g.issue == "LOCAL":
os.system("systemctl status mariadb|grep Active > /tmp/_dbstat")
if g.issue == "REMOTE":
os.system("systemctl status mysql|grep Active > /tmp/_dbstat")
with open('/tmp/_dbstat', 'r') as file: htext = file.read()
update.message.reply_text(htext)
def restart_db_command(update: Update, context: CallbackContext) -> None:
touch("/tmp/_rl_restart_mysql")
htext = f'Restarting MariaDB in {getsecs()} secs.'
update.message.reply_text(htext)
def botstat_command(update: Update, context: CallbackContext) -> None:
htext = statProcess("v2.py")
update.message.reply_text(htext)
def stopbot_command(update: Update, context: CallbackContext) -> None:
htext = killProcessRunning("v2.py")
update.message.reply_text(htext)
def restartbot_command(update: Update, context: CallbackContext) -> None:
killProcessRunning("v2.py")
os.system("nohup ./v2.py &")
htext = "Bot started"
update.message.reply_text(htext)
def kill_lis_command(update: Update, context: CallbackContext) -> None:
killProcessRunning("tbot_listener.py")
def restart_lis_command(update: Update, context: CallbackContext) -> None:
os.system("restart_listener.sh")
# htext = "Bot started"
# update.message.reply_text(htext)
def suspend_command(update: Update, context: CallbackContext) -> None:
htext = suspendProcess("v2.py")
update.message.reply_text(htext)
def resume_command(update: Update, context: CallbackContext) -> None:
htext = resumeProcess("v2.py")
update.message.reply_text(htext)
def df_command(update: Update, context: CallbackContext) -> None:
os.system(" df -h|grep -v loop|grep -v tmp|grep -v run|grep dev > /tmp/_dstats")
with open('/tmp/_dstats', 'r') as file: htext = file.read()
loqreq("/df")
update.message.reply_text(htext)
def tail_command(update: Update, context: CallbackContext) -> None:
os.system("tail nohup.out|grep -v '\r' > /tmp/_tail")
with open('/tmp/_tail', 'r') as file: htext = file.read()
update.message.reply_text(htext)
def tail_listener_command(update: Update, context: CallbackContext) -> None:
os.system("nl logs/listener.log|tail > /tmp/_tail_listener")
with open('/tmp/_tail_listener', 'r') as file: htext = file.read()
update.message.reply_text(htext)
def x_command(update: Update, context: CallbackContext) -> None:
command = "./j_plot_port.py > /dev/null 2>&1"
os.system(command)
update.message.reply_document(document=open("images/plot_port.png",'rb'))
os.remove("images/plot_port.png")
def zxc_command(update: Update, context: CallbackContext) -> None:
cmd = ' '.join(map(str, context.args))
print(f"[{cmd}]")
os.system(f"{cmd} > > /tmp/_zxc 2>&1")
with open('/tmp/_zxc', 'r') as file: htext = file.read()
os.remove("/tmp/_zxc")
htext = htext[:4000]
update.message.reply_text(htext)
def main():
updater = Updater(token)
dispatcher = updater.dispatcher
dispatcher.add_handler(CommandHandler("zxc",zxc_command))
for i in range(len(lary)):
if lary[i][0] != "#":
dispatcher.add_handler(CommandHandler(lary[i][0], eval(lary[i][1])))
updater.start_polling()
print("Listening...")
# updater.idle()
if __name__ == '__main__':
main()
